Draper's foothill neighborhoods sit close to open space, dry vegetation, and terrain where wildfire conditions can change quickly. During a fire, wind-driven embers may travel far ahead of visible flames and collect on horizontal surfaces, inside board gaps, beneath decks, or against the home. An aging wood deck can become a fuel source rather than a safe outdoor living area.
Wildfire-resistant design, more accurately called ignition-resistant design, reduces vulnerabilities from embers, radiant heat, and limited flame exposure. No residential deck is completely fireproof, but material selection and careful detailing can make a meaningful difference. We evaluate the entire assembly, including decking, framing, stairs, railings, under-deck storage, and the point where the deck connects to the house.
That whole-system approach matters. A fire-resistant walking surface may still be undermined by exposed wood joists, combustible furniture, or debris trapped below. We also recommend keeping vegetation, firewood, cushions, and other fuel sources away from the structure. Firewise USA guidance emphasizes home hardening as one part of a broader strategy, alongside defensible space and regular maintenance.

Material choice is the starting point, but the best option depends on exposure, budget, appearance, and the performance of the complete system.
Aluminum and steel provide a noncombustible alternative for decking and, in some systems, framing. Aluminum decking resists ignition and moisture, making it attractive for high-exposure locations. It can have a more manufactured appearance and may transmit sound differently than wood or composite, so we discuss those tradeoffs during design.
Capped composite and PVC decking offer low maintenance and a familiar deck appearance. Some products have tested fire performance or Class A ratings, while others may contain wood fibers or plastics with different flame-spread characteristics. Homeowners should review the exact product's testing and installation requirements rather than assuming every composite board performs the same way. In Utah, capped composite also handles harsh UV, snow melt, splinters, and routine maintenance better than many natural woods.
Fused bamboo systems, such as dassoXTR, offer a dense, wood-like appearance with documented exterior fire testing for certain applications and profiles. Product certifications still need to match the intended installation and local requirements.
Natural cedar, redwood, and treated lumber remain attractive, workable choices, but they are combustible and demand ongoing sealing and inspection. For a Draper deck replacement near wildfire-prone slopes, we generally favor a tested composite, PVC, aluminum, or another ignition-resistant system over untreated wood.

A safer deck begins below the surface. We design the framing, connections, and details as deliberately as the visible decking.
Where project conditions and product specifications allow, metal or other ignition-resistant framing can reduce combustible material. When wood framing is appropriate, we protect it through sound construction, proper clearances, and details that limit ember collection. Hot-dip galvanized or stainless hardware helps the structure withstand Utah's moisture swings and snow loads.
Deck boards need consistent spacing for drainage, but oversized or irregular gaps can allow embers and leaves to collect below. We follow the selected manufacturer's spacing requirements and use clean, consistent installation. The area beneath an elevated deck should not become an open storage closet. Skirting, screening, or other solutions may help, but they must balance ember control, ventilation, drainage, and code requirements.
Ledger attachment, flashing, siding transitions, stair locations, and nearby doors deserve careful attention. The deck should not create an easy path for heat or flame to reach the wall assembly. We also inspect existing framing before deciding whether resurfacing is sensible. If the structure has rot, inadequate footings, or questionable connections, replacement is safer than covering the problem with new boards.
Low-voltage LED lighting in stair risers and post caps improves visibility without open flames. Pergolas provide shade, but their timber components and fabric elements must be planned with the surrounding exposure in mind. Outdoor kitchens, fire features, and hot tubs also require appropriate clearances and structural reinforcement. A successful deck replacement starts with a site review, not a catalog. We assess elevation, soil and terrain, existing footings, snow-load demands, wildfire exposure, drainage, and how the new structure will meet the home. Utah's freeze-thaw cycle makes deep footings especially important: we typically place concrete footings well below the local frost line, often 30 inches or more depending on project requirements.
Permits and HOA approvals can affect both the schedule and the design. Draper projects may require structural plans, setbacks, guard and stair details, and documentation for the selected decking system. If the home is in an HOA community, visual standards may govern railing profiles, colors, lighting, and pergola placement. We handle the permitting process and provide the information needed for review instead of leaving homeowners to assemble technical documents themselves.
We also plan for Utah's 100-degree summers and heavy winter snow. Proper joist spacing, beams, connections, drainage, and flashing help prevent sagging, movement, and premature deterioration. For elevated decks, a dry-space system such as Trex RainEscape can divert water into a usable patio below, provided the full assembly is designed and maintained correctly.
